Rachel Barron Injured in Single-Vehicle Accident in Hockley County, TX
Hockley County, TX -- October 23, 2022, Rachel Barron was injured following an accident where her vehicle crashed and overturned.
Authorities said that the crash took place at around 2:00 a.m. along US highway 385 near mile marker 204.

Initial details said that 23-year-old Rachel Barron was in a Jeep Cherokee traveling northbound on US 385. The vehicle somehow went off the right side of the road, then swerved left where it crashed through a barrier. This caused the vehicle to flip over.
Barron sustained injuries said to be incapacitating. No others were said to be involved. More information is required to confirm any further information.
